Transaction 24e2dedcfba4d006ff6de366f76705c0674876258c63c929039b973809050e93

1 Input
1 Outputs
  • 24e2dedcfba4d006ff6de366f76705c0674876258c63c929039b973809050e93:0
  • value  1111426
    address  39qCV6PcnL5cKKeycdGsUNkv7Ee2c3UvDi